#029374 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#029374 is composed of 0.8% red, 57.6%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 21.1%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 167.2 degrees, a saturation of 97.3% and a lightness of 29.2%. #029374 color hex could be obtained by blending #04ffe8 with #002700. Closest websafe color is: #009966.

#029374 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#029374 has RGB values of R:2, G:147,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0.99, M:0, Y:0.21,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 168820.

Shades and Tints of #029374
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000c09 is the darkest color, while #f7fff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#029374
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#474e4d is the less saturated color, while #029374 is the most saturated one.
